The Workplace Gender Equality Agency (WGEA/Agency) is the Australian Government’s key agency charged with promoting and improving gender equality in Australian workplaces, through the provision of advice and assistance to employers and the assessment and measurement of workplace gender data. Our Agency was established by the Workplace Gender Equality Act 2012 (Act).

WGEA is seeking a Business Analyst to identify and develop enhancements to the employer experience when reporting annually to the agency. This includes a review of current, business processes, the supporting technology, and support desk operations. The role is an integral part of the WGEA commitment to ongoing improvement and reducing the burden on employers to support reporting and compliance requirements
